8 July 2022

Northern Bear plc

("Northern Bear" or the "Company")

 

Settlement of Legal Claim

 

The board of directors of Northern Bear plc (the "Board") is pleased to
announce that a settlement of £0.6 million has been agreed in respect of a
legal claim against one of the Company's subsidiaries, Springs Roofing Limited
("Springs"), by Engie Regeneration (FHM) Limited ("Engie").  There are no
other pending legal claims against the Group or its subsidiaries, and we are
not aware of any matter that could lead to a material legal claim.

Springs received notice of formal court proceedings in the sum of £1.9
million plus costs in December 2021.  The claim related to roofing work
undertaken over a two-year period from April 2009 to March 2011 on eight
separate care home properties.

Engie had experienced performance issues with various aspects of the
buildings, including their roof coverings, and subsequently employed Springs
to re-roof all eight properties at normal commercial rates.  Springs'
directors believe the performance issues were caused by problems with the
design of the buildings for which Springs had no responsibility.  The
re-roofing work was carried out to a different specification to the original
contract with different materials being used.

Engie subsequently made a claim under its insurance policy in respect of the
rectification work.  Engie, in conjunction with its insurers, made a claim
against Springs and the conduct of that claim was subrogated to its
insurers.  The Springs directors believe that the claim was without merit.
This position was supported by comprehensive third party technical expert and
legal advice.

In reaching the agreed settlement set out above, the Board and the Springs
directors considered, in conjunction with its legal advisers, the management
time likely to be involved, the future legal costs which would be incurred in
defending the claim, including a sizeable sum which would have been
irrecoverable should Springs have successfully defended the claim, and the
commercial risk of any matter of litigation.

Springs and Northern Bear's other subsidiaries retain excellent commercial
relationships with Engie's regional and national management team. As such,
Engie continues to be an important and valued customer for the Group.

The settlement of £0.6m, which can be satisfied from the Company's existing
resources, will be recorded as an exceptional item in the Group's annual
results to 31 March 2022, which are expected to be released in the week
commencing 18 July 2022.
